Introduction to Figma UI Design
In the digital era, user interface (UI) design plays a crucial role in how people interact with websites, applications, and digital products. A visually appealing, intuitive, and user-friendly interface can determine the success or failure of a product. Among the various design tools available today, Figma has emerged as one of the most popular platforms for UI and UX designers.
Figma stands out because it is cloud-based, making collaboration effortless for teams. Whether you are a beginner or a professional, Figma provides a clean, intuitive interface with powerful features that simplify UI design. This beginner’s guide to Figma UI design will walk you through the basics, from understanding the platform to designing your first interface.
Why Choose Figma for UI Design?
Before we jump into the practical steps, let’s understand why Figma is highly preferred by designers worldwide:
- Cloud-Based Collaboration: Teams can work on the same file in real time, just like Google Docs.
- Cross-Platform: Accessible from web browsers, Windows, macOS, and even on mobile for previewing.
- Free Plan Available: Beginners can start for free with generous features.
- No Installation Hassle: Runs in the browser without heavy system requirements.
- Plugin Ecosystem: Rich library of plugins to boost productivity.
- Version Control: Automatically saves work and maintains history.
With these advantages, Figma has become a go-to design tool for freelancers, startups, and even enterprise-level design teams.
Getting Started with Figma
Create Your Account
- Go to Figma.com.
- Sign up with your email, Google account, or other login options.
- Once registered, you’ll be directed to the Figma dashboard.
Understand the Interface
The Figma workspace includes:
- Toolbar (top): Houses selection tools, shapes, frames, and text.
- Layers Panel (left): Shows all objects and groups in your file.
- Canvas (center): Where your designs take shape.
- Properties Panel (right): Controls colors, typography, sizing, and more.
Learn the Basics
- Frames: Containers for your designs (like artboards in Adobe XD or Sketch).
- Shapes & Text: Add rectangles, circles, and text blocks to create components.
- Components: Reusable UI elements that maintain consistency.
- Grids & Layouts: Essential for aligning design elements.
Essential Figma Features for Beginners
Frames and Layouts
Frames are the foundation of any UI design. They act as a canvas or container for buttons, navigation bars, or entire screens. Beginners should practice creating frames for different devices, such as mobile or desktop layouts.
Components and Variants
Components allow you to reuse design elements, like buttons or icons, across multiple screens. Variants help you manage different states of the same component (hover, active, disabled).
Styles
Figma lets you define and reuse styles for typography, colors, and effects. This ensures design consistency across projects.
Prototyping
You can create clickable prototypes by linking frames. This is useful for presenting designs to clients or stakeholders without writing code.
Collaboration Tools
Figma allows multiple users to comment directly on designs, eliminating long feedback cycles.
Plugins
Plugins enhance your design workflow. Some useful plugins for beginners are:
- Unsplash: Insert free stock photos.
- Iconify: Access thousands of icons.
- Charts: Generate sample data visualizations.
Step-by-Step: Designing Your First UI in Figma
Let’s design a simple mobile login screen to put theory into practice.
Create a Frame
- Select the Frame Tool (F).
- Choose a preset mobile screen size (e.g., iPhone 14).
Add a Background
- Click on the canvas.
- Choose a background color from the Properties Panel.
Add a Logo
- Use the Text Tool (T) to type your brand name.
- Customize the font and color.
Insert Input Fields
- Draw rectangles to represent input boxes.
- Label them as “Email” and “Password.”
- Step 5: Create a Button
- Add a rectangle for the button shape.
- Add text “Login.”
- Turn it into a component for reuse.
Prototype It
- Switch to Prototype Mode.
- Link the “Login” button to another frame (like a “Home” screen).
Congratulations! You’ve designed your first UI screen in Figma.
Best Practices for Beginner UI Designers
- Follow Design Principles: Balance, contrast, and alignment are fundamental.
- Keep It Simple: Avoid clutter. Minimalism improves usability.
- Use Grids: A structured layout ensures consistency.
- Maintain Accessibility: Ensure text readability and color contrast.
- Gather Feedback: Share designs with peers and improve iteratively.
- Stay Updated: Figma constantly releases new features—keep learning.
Common Mistakes Beginners Make in Figma
- Ignoring layers and naming conventions.
- Overusing too many fonts or colors.
- Not using components, leading to inconsistent design.
- Forgetting mobile responsiveness.
- Skipping alignment and spacing rules.
By avoiding these mistakes, you’ll improve faster as a UI designer.
Resources to Learn Figma UI Design
- Figma Community: Access free templates, UI kits, and plugins.
- YouTube Tutorials: Channels like Flux Academy and DesignCode provide hands-on lessons.
- Online Courses: Platforms like Coursera, Skillshare, and Udemy offer structured learning paths.
- Practice Projects: Recreate popular apps like Instagram or Spotify for practice.
Future of UI Design with Figma
Figma’s popularity continues to grow, especially after Adobe’s involvement in its acquisition talks. With constant improvements, integration with tools like FigJam (for brainstorming), and its seamless prototyping capabilities, Figma is positioned to dominate the UI/UX design landscape for years to come.
Conclusion
Figma has redefined the way designers approach UI design. For beginners, its easy-to-use interface, collaborative features, and cloud accessibility make it the perfect tool to start your design journey. By mastering the basics—frames, components, prototyping—you’ll be on your way to creating stunning and user-friendly designs.
Whether you aim to become a professional UI/UX designer or just want to design personal projects, Figma is a skill worth learning.
Ready to kickstart your design career? Start exploring Figma UI Design today and create professional-quality interfaces without limits!